PAE is seeking a motivated and inquisitive Entry-Level Electrical Engineer to join our team in a hybrid office environment in our Seattle office. This role is designed for a proactive individual looking to build a career in electrical system design for the built environment. Under the mentorship of experienced project leads, you will transition from academic theory to professional practice, learning to design and model power distribution, lighting, and technology systems. You will play a foundational role in supporting project teams while developing technical mastery in industry-standard software and electrical codes.

Founded in 1967, PAE is a leading sustainable engineering and consulting firm on a mission to deliver clean air, energy, and water for all. We specialize in mechanical, electrical, and plumbing engineering, building performance analysis, technology design, and lighting design (LUMA). PAE designs some of the nation's highest-performing and most regenerative built environments across the U.S., from Living Buildings to all-electric buildings and beyond. Learn more at pae-engineers.com .
Our portfolio includes over 100 LEED Platinum projects as well as dozens of projects that have either achieved or are pursuing the Living Building Challenge, Passive House, Architecture 2030, Carbon Neutral, Net Zero Energy, and Net Zero Water.
